What Is Fluted Filter Paper?

Fluted filter paper is a circular piece of filter paper folded in an accordion style and used to filter solid impurities from a liquid during gravity filtration. The fluting of the paper increases the surface area of the filter.
Filter paper is fluted by folding a circular piece in half three times without unfolding the paper between folds. The paper is unfolded twice, creating a semicircle with four quarter sections created by the creases. Each quarter is folded in half using a fan fold by alternating folding up and down. The paper is unfolded back to a full circle and placed in a funnel. The liquid being filtered is poured through the filter paper and caught in a container below the funnel.
